The feature catalogue

ReservationBay is one product with one price list. Your plan does not decide which features you get. What decides it is what you switch on.

Always on

These are the spine of a rental business and cannot be switched off:

FeatureWhat it gives you
DashboardToday's figures, check-ins and check-outs.
BookingsThe booking list, the calendar, creating and editing bookings, check-in and check-out.
CustomersThe customer list, their history and their details.
LocationsYour rental locations, opening hours and closed days.
ResourcesYour stock, availability and maintenance.
PaymentsYour accepted payment methods, your wallet and your transactions. This one is always visible on purpose: you are billed whether or not you look at the screen, and a wallet that goes negative has a seven-day deadline attached.

Optional

These you turn on and off for the whole company under Settings → Features, and grant per staff member under Settings → Users.

FeatureWhat it gives you
ReportsThe reporting page: occupancy, revenue, booking sources, deposits, promotions, unmet demand and a year-on-year comparison, each exportable as CSV.
ReviewsAutomatic review requests to renters after their rental, and a page to publish, hide or reply to what comes in.
BundlesSelling several categories together as one product, a package or a kit.
Extras & waiversAdd-ons on a booking that are not objects: helmets, cleaning fees, a damage waiver as a percentage of the rental.
Discount codesPercentage or fixed-amount codes, scoped by date, location, category, minimum amount and number of uses.
VouchersGift cards with a balance that can be spent across several bookings.
DocumentsContract, quote and packing-slip templates, and generating branded PDFs from a booking.
SignaturesSigning a contract on a tablet at the counter, or by emailing the customer a single-use signing link. Has no menu item of its own. It appears inside the booking and document screens.
IntegrationsThe website widget builder, calendar sync, and connections to other systems.
AdministrationYour payment overview, the invoices ReservationBay sent you, and yearly booking exports.

Switching a feature off

Turning something off hides it from everyone's menu immediately, and its pages stop being reachable. Nothing is deleted. Your vouchers, your reviews and your document templates are still there, and switching the feature back on brings them straight back.

Suggestions during setup

The setup wizard pre-ticks the features that businesses in your branch usually want: waivers and signatures for boats and scooters, vouchers and reviews for a bike shop. It is a starting point, not a decision: change it in the wizard or at any time afterwards.
